FCB Ulka bags Mid-day's creative mandate
FCB Ulka has bagged the creative duties of Mid-day Infomedia. The mandate includes creative duties for Gujarati Mid-day and Urdu newspaper Inquilab
 
Sandeep Khosla, CEO, Mid-day Infomedia, said, “We are pleased to have FCB Ulka as our creative partner. Their sound understanding of the media industry and their customised approach would give us that extra edge to take our brands to the next level. We look forward to creating effective communication across Mid-day, Gujarati Mid-day and Inquilab with them on board.”
 
Nitin Karkare, CEO, FCB Ulka, added, "I am delighted that Mid-day has selected FCB Ulka as their creative partner. Mid-day is the soul of Mumbai and I personally have fond memories of having grown up reading the paper. Look forward to working with them to help Mid-day reclaim its place in the sun.”
